Ayeza Khan under severe criticism for refraining from posting against Indian aggression

Renowned actress Ayeza Khan is currently under severe criticism for one of her posts on social media. Actress Ayeza Khan has often faced criticism for her silence on international and political issues.

However, her silence after the war imposed on Pakistan by India after the Pahalgam attack was very unpleasant for her fans.

On which one of her posts added fuel to the fire. Ayeza Khan had posted that I stand with humanity. Humanity is above religion, race, nationality, politics or personal interests.

Social media users called the post insensitive and evasive, saying that Pakistan is going through a difficult time and making vague statements at this time is tantamount to turning a blind eye to the problem.

One user wrote that this is the height of hypocrisy! Yesterday 27 Pakistanis were martyred and this lady is talking about humanity? Boycott her!”

Another user commented that the entertainment industry has shown its true colors. An international fan also expressed his displeasure, saying that you don’t know what state your country is in? Post the dramas later.

After which #BoycottAyezaKhan is trending on social media against Ayeza Khan, where thousands of users are severely criticizing her statement and behavior.
